UNC's team of Larry Fedora and Roy Williams finished tied for eighth at -6 in the 2012 Chick-fil-A Bowl Challenge and won $20,000 for scholarships. The Chick-fil-A Bowl Challenge is the country's premier head coach and celebrity charity golf event featuring NCAA head coaches and former athletes and celebrities from the same school competing for a share of a $520,000 scholarship purse.
